SUPPORT-8474: Fix
This commit is contained in:
parent
ee845873bc
commit
40044e43c1
3 changed files with 15 additions and 6 deletions
|
|
@ -1,5 +1,7 @@
|
|||
package ru.micord.ervu.security.esia.config;
|
||||
|
||||
import java.util.Arrays;
|
||||
|
||||
import org.springframework.beans.factory.annotation.Value;
|
||||
import org.springframework.stereotype.Component;
|
||||
|
||||
|
|
@ -15,6 +17,9 @@ public class EsiaConfig {
|
|||
@Value("${esia-org-scopes:#{null}}")
|
||||
private String esiaOrgScopes;
|
||||
|
||||
@Value("${esia-org-scope-url:#{null}}")
|
||||
private String orgScopeUrl;
|
||||
|
||||
@Value("${esia-uri.base-uri:#{null}}")
|
||||
private String esiaBaseUri;
|
||||
|
||||
|
|
@ -54,11 +59,13 @@ public class EsiaConfig {
|
|||
}
|
||||
|
||||
public String getEsiaOrgScopes() {
|
||||
return esiaOrgScopes;
|
||||
String[] scopeItems = esiaOrgScopes.split(",");
|
||||
return String.join(" ", Arrays.stream(scopeItems).map(item -> orgScopeUrl + item.trim()).toArray(String[]::new));
|
||||
}
|
||||
|
||||
public String getEsiaScopes() {
|
||||
return esiaScopes;
|
||||
String[] scopeItems = esiaScopes.split(",");
|
||||
return String.join(" ", Arrays.stream(scopeItems).map(String::trim).toArray(String[]::new));
|
||||
}
|
||||
|
||||
public String getClientId() {
|
||||
|
|
|
|||
|
|
@ -40,8 +40,9 @@ xa-data-source add \
|
|||
/system-property=ervu.fileupload.max_file_size:add(value="5242880")
|
||||
/system-property=ervu.fileupload.max_request_size:add(value="6291456")
|
||||
/system-property=ervu.fileupload.file_size_threshold:add(value="0")
|
||||
/system-property=esia-scopes:add(value="fullname snils id_doc birthdate usr_org openid")
|
||||
/system-property=esia-org-scopes:add(value="http://esia.gosuslugi.ru/org_fullname http://esia.gosuslugi.ru/org_shortname http://esia.gosuslugi.ru/org_brhs http://esia.gosuslugi.ru/org_brhs_ctts http://esia.gosuslugi.ru/org_brhs_addrs http://esia.gosuslugi.ru/org_type http://esia.gosuslugi.ru/org_ogrn http://esia.gosuslugi.ru/org_inn http://esia.gosuslugi.ru/org_leg http://esia.gosuslugi.ru/org_kpp http://esia.gosuslugi.ru/org_ctts http://esia.gosuslugi.ru/org_addrs http://esia.gosuslugi.ru/org_grps http://esia.gosuslugi.ru/org_emps")
|
||||
/system-property=esia-scopes:add(value="fullname, snils, id_doc, birthdate, usr_org, openid")
|
||||
/system-property=esia-org-scopes:add(value="org_fullname, org_shortname, org_brhs, org_brhs_ctts, org_brhs_addrs, org_type, org_ogrn, org_inn, org_leg, org_kpp, org_ctts, org_addrs, org_grps, org_emps")
|
||||
/system-property=esia-org-scope-url:add(value="http://esia.gosuslugi.ru/")
|
||||
/system-property=esia-uri.base-uri:add(value="https://esia-portal1.test.gosuslugi.ru/")
|
||||
/system-property=esia-uri.code-path:add(value="https://esia-portal1.test.gosuslugi.ru/aas/oauth2/v2/ac")
|
||||
/system-property=esia-uri.token-path:add(value="https://esia-portal1.test.gosuslugi.ru/aas/oauth2/v3/te")
|
||||
|
|
|
|||
|
|
@ -66,8 +66,9 @@
|
|||
<property name="ervu.fileupload.max_file_size" value="5242880"/>
|
||||
<property name="ervu.fileupload.max_request_size" value="6291456"/>
|
||||
<property name="ervu.fileupload.file_size_threshold" value="0"/>
|
||||
<property name="esia-scopes" value="fullname snils id_doc birthdate usr_org openid"/>
|
||||
<property name="esia-org-scopes" value="http://esia.gosuslugi.ru/org_fullname http://esia.gosuslugi.ru/org_shortname http://esia.gosuslugi.ru/org_brhs http://esia.gosuslugi.ru/org_brhs_ctts http://esia.gosuslugi.ru/org_brhs_addrs http://esia.gosuslugi.ru/org_type http://esia.gosuslugi.ru/org_ogrn http://esia.gosuslugi.ru/org_inn http://esia.gosuslugi.ru/org_leg http://esia.gosuslugi.ru/org_kpp http://esia.gosuslugi.ru/org_ctts http://esia.gosuslugi.ru/org_addrs http://esia.gosuslugi.ru/org_grps http://esia.gosuslugi.ru/org_emps"/>
|
||||
<property name="esia-scopes" value="fullname, snils, id_doc, birthdate, usr_org, openid"/>
|
||||
<property name="esia-org-scopes" value="org_fullname, org_shortname, org_brhs, org_brhs_ctts, org_brhs_addrs, org_type, org_ogrn, org_inn, org_leg, org_kpp, org_ctts, org_addrs, org_grps, org_emps"/>
|
||||
<property name="esia-org-scope-url" value="http://esia.gosuslugi.ru/"/>
|
||||
<property name="esia-uri.base-uri" value="https://esia-portal1.test.gosuslugi.ru/"/>
|
||||
<property name="esia-uri.code-path" value="https://esia-portal1.test.gosuslugi.ru/aas/oauth2/v2/ac"/>
|
||||
<property name="esia-uri.token-path" value="https://esia-portal1.test.gosuslugi.ru/aas/oauth2/v3/te"/>
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ue